Output 2517ffe836b7870114e328031ecae7f934bb085be771af96469bfb631589758e:2

value
12918716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5d14fbbbca6de0d00feda5ab0ed3b4f3f0f0595 OP_EQUAL
address
3NeBQgriMN8PqvMjXwinE8dMu6SB8gTT5f
transaction
2517ffe836b7870114e328031ecae7f934bb085be771af96469bfb631589758e
spent
true